The Benefits of Planted Gabion Walls in Modern Construction
In the world of contemporary construction, sustainability and aesthetic appeal play a significant role in design choices. One innovative solution that marries these two aspects is the planted gabion wall. These structures, which incorporate natural elements into their design, are rapidly gaining popularity among architects, landscape designers, and builders alike. This article delves into the concept of planted gabion walls, their benefits, and their increasing prevalence in various construction projects.
The Benefits of Planted Gabion Walls in Modern Construction
One of the primary benefits of planted gabion walls is their ability to integrate seamlessly into the surrounding environment. The plantings can include various species of grasses, flowers, and even small shrubs, creating a green aesthetic that softens the hard edges of traditional stone walls. This green façade does more than just look good; it plays a crucial role in managing stormwater runoff, reducing the risk of erosion, and improving the overall ecological balance of the area. The vegetation absorbs excess water, filters pollutants, and provides habitat for various species, thereby fostering a healthier ecosystem.
Another significant advantage of planted gabion walls is their structural resilience. The use of natural stone or recycled materials within the gabions ensures that these walls are durable and environmentally friendly. They are capable of withstanding extreme weather conditions and require minimal maintenance compared to other forms of landscaping. Moreover, the vegetation incorporated into these walls improves their stability. As roots grow and establish themselves within the structures, they help reinforce the wall, making it less susceptible to erosion and collapse.
Cost-effectiveness is another compelling reason for the rise of planted gabion walls. While the initial installation may involve some investment, the longevity and low maintenance requirements of these structures often make them more economical in the long run. Additionally, they can be crafted from locally sourced materials, which further reduces costs and transportation emissions. Across various industries, from municipal projects to private landscaping, the versatility and adaptability of planted gabion walls are becoming apparent.
Planted gabion walls also offer aesthetic versatility, allowing designers to create unique and visually appealing landscapes. They can be customized in terms of height, width, and the variety of plant species used. This flexibility makes them suitable for a wide range of applications—whether in urban settings where space is limited, or in rural areas that require extensive erosion control. The ability to tailor the design to fit specific environmental needs and aesthetic preferences has led to their increased adoption worldwide.
